Have a 'continental' Christmas
The
Continental Market is back for Christmas - so don't miss the chance
to pick up some unusual Yuletide treats.
On Friday 7 and Sunday 9 December professional traders from across
the continent will be bringing stalls laden with goods to the
streets of Ormskirk town centre.
With everything from Belgium chocolates, Turkish delight and
Brittany biscuits to French cheese, Italian deli items and fine
festive wines, you're sure to find something to tickle your taste
buds.
Along with the many delicious food items, there will also be a wide
range of other gift ideas to choose from including leather goods,
Marseille soaps, beautiful Peruvian clothes, jewellery and
children's toys.
Cllr David Westley, Portfolio Holder for Street Scene, said: "This
is a perfect chance to pick up some unusual stocking fillers for
Christmas. The Continental Market has proved to be a very popular
attraction in the town centre, especially during the festive
season, and I hope that people will make the most of this
opportunity to experience a taste of the continent this
Christmas."
